Output 01ee66c4f144f326499c66d85df96bfe1700c2d7b4dbf84b38af6b5402bf8582:1

value
632934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ad0e787936276ae07e9629b90714849ec414b05 OP_EQUAL
address
3LBQgE6LWtSS3NV6ta1G4HpW5fBF92xhXW
transaction
01ee66c4f144f326499c66d85df96bfe1700c2d7b4dbf84b38af6b5402bf8582
spent
true